If number reads “Forty-five lakh sixty-one thousand two-hundred thirty-four” then the sum of the digits in the number is
A. 45
B. 25
C. 15
D 65

Hint: We had to only write the given statement form of the number to its numerical form. And then we will get the sum of the digits of the number by adding each digit.

Complete step-by-step answer:
As we know that when we are given any number in statement form and asked to write it in numerical form, then we break the statements into small parts like lakhs, thousand, hundred etc and then write each part in numerical form and then add them to get the number in numerical form.
Now as we can see that the given number in statement form is
Forty-five lakh sixty-one thousand two-hundred thirty-four
So, forty-five lakhs are equal to 45,00,000
Sixty-one thousand are equal to 61,000
Two hundred is equal to 200
And, thirty-four is written as 34.
So, the complete statement will be 45,00,000 + 61,000 + 200 + 34 = 45,61,234
Now, we are asked to find the sum of the digits of 45,61,234.
And as we know that if abcdef is any number then the sum of its digits will be equal to a + b + c + d + e + f.
So, the sum of the digits of 45,61,234 will be 4 + 5 + 6 + 1 + 2 + 3 + 4 = 25
Hence, the correct option will be B.

Note:Whenever we come up with this type of problem where we are asked to write the given number in statement form to the numerical form or asked to find the sum of the digits of the number then we had to break the given statement into small parts like lakhs, thousands, hundred etc. And write the numerical form of each part and then on adding all the parts we will get the required number in numerical form and to find the sum of the digits we add all the digits of the number in numerical form.
